It was written in the year 137 of the Fifth Age. The whispers Bilrach was hearing have turned into voices. Bilrach is only a few years from the end, but he fears progress will be slow, as the problems mentioned in the previous entry have caused him to expend a lot of power protecting himself at the expense of his followers.

- Written in the year 137 of the Fifth Age. The whispers, who he thinks belong to Zamorak, have turned to voices, and he is close to him now. Bilrach is only a few years from the end, but he fears progress will be slow. So much of his power is spent defensively, propping up the floors that threaten to crash down on him. The floors above him are warped, out of control, and dangerously unstable, and he has trouble containing them. Because of that, he has chosen to protect just himself, any followers left behind are lost to corruption. Though he fears that a foe will rise that even he can't defeat himself. Still, he moves on alone; if he at least makes it a little deeper, the area will serve as a challenge for anyone who tries to reach him.

It is interesting to note that he now suspects a greater foe to arise that he can't defeat. It is also interesting to point out that he thinks the whispers are Zamorak, which they clearly aren't, according to the other journals, and him questioning that he'd be able to enter the world on his own if he had such influence. It seems the voices have manipulated him, whether intentional or not, into thinking they were his master, Zamorak.
